Abus WBA60 Wall / Floor Anchor

Ask A Question x

The ABUS WBA60 Wall / Floor Anchor gives you a fixed point to lock your bike to at home, in a garage, shed, bike room or covered storage area. It is useful when there is no solid post, rack or ground anchor already available.

This is not a bike lock by itself. It is the anchor point your lock attaches to. Pair it with a strong chain, D-lock or folding lock to secure the bike frame to something fixed, rather than just locking the wheel or linking bikes together.

Product type: Wall or floor security anchor

Best use: Garages, sheds, carports, bike rooms and home storage

Security rating: ABUS Global Protection Standard level 10

Shackle: 10 mm hardened special steel

Mounting: Wall or floor installation

Dimensions: 80 mm wide x 118 mm high

Clearance: 55 mm horizontal clearance, 52 mm vertical clearance

Weight: 450 g

Good to know: Mounting accessories included. Lock sold separately.

Good to know

The WBA60 needs to be installed into a suitable solid surface. Before fitting it, check the wall or floor material and make sure the anchor location gives you enough room to pass your lock through the bike frame.

For best security, position the anchor so the lock can secure the main frame triangle or another strong part of the bike. Avoid setups where the lock only captures a wheel, rack or easily removable part.

For high-value bikes, e-bikes or cargo bikes, use a strong lock with the anchor. A heavy chain is often the easiest match because it gives good reach around the frame and anchor, especially if you are locking more than one bike.
